Welcome to on-call for Nightjar, our scheduler for nightly data backfills at Ferrowave. If a backfill stalls past 03:00, check the runner queue first — nine times out of ten it's a stuck lock. You can safely requeue from the Nightjar console. If the console itself is locked out, you'll need the recovery passphrase below.

vault phrase of tajop-haduf = holath-brivan-wenax

The Givenly receipt mailer exposes POST /receipts/resend for re-issuing donation receipts after a delivery failure. Requests must specify the donation reference and a reason code; the mailer deduplicates within a 24-hour window, so repeated calls are safe. On-call engineers should authenticate each request with the bearer token shown immediately below.

bearer token for tawig-bahif: eyJhbGciOiJIUzI1NiIsInR5cCI6IkpXVCJ9.eyJzdWIiOiIo-yiO33jvEIn0.T9qLInSAqhTN

Handover note — Crumbwheel order cutoffs.

Welcome aboard. The bakery cutoff rule in Crumbwheel closes same-day orders at 14:00 local to each storefront, not UTC — this has bitten us twice. Holiday overrides live in the calendar service and take precedence silently, so always check there first when a cutoff looks wrong. To unlock the calendar service's admin console after a restart, enter the recovery passphrase below.

vault phrase of bagap-bahaf = silion-pelox-sorox-casdor-quenwyn-fraax-eliox-praael-kelion-quenvan-kasox-rusael-norius-belvan

## Changelog — Font vendoring defaults changed

As of this release, the Bracken UI build no longer fetches third-party fonts at build time. All typefaces used by the Lanternwell suite are now vendored into the repo under a dedicated assets directory, and the fetch step is skipped by default. If you're onboarding, nothing to install — the fonts travel with the checkout. The build flags controlling this behavior are listed below.

settings of hadup-yafog:
LAMAEL_PIN=3761
LAMAEL_TENANT=istmir
LAMAEL_METRICS_HOST=metrics.lamael.plorvasys.test
LAMAEL_SEAL=seal_8ea68500
LAMAEL_STANDBY_TEAM=fraok